There once was a seal

Who was caught sunbathing

Without her Cape of Seal Skin

She became captive to a foreign reality

Of children and earthen pleasures

A child offspring

Found the hidden once discarded

Cloak

Offering it up to the mother of desires

Who leaped with recognition

Into who she once was

Yet encountering longing

For sea and turf

It is the Longing

That defines the days
